- The distance between Johannesburg, South Africa and Lyngvig Fyr, Denmark is approximately 9,337 km or 5,802 mi.
- To reach Johannesburg in this distance one would set out from Lyngvig Fyr bearing 161.9° or SSE and follow the great circles arc to approach Johannesburg bearing 168.9° or S .
- Johannesburg has a mid-latitude cool steppe climate (BSk) whereas Lyngvig Fyr has a marine west coast climate (Cfb).
- Johannesburg is in or near the warm temperate dry forest biome whereas Lyngvig Fyr is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ome.
- The mean annual temperature is 8 °C (14.3°F) warmer.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 6.5 °C (11.7°F) less in Johannesburg. The continentality subtype is barely hyperoceanic as opposed to truly oceanic.
- Total annual precipitation averages 145 mm (5.7 in) less which is equivalent to 145 l/m² (3.56 US gal/ft²) or 1,450,000 l/ha (155,015 US gal/ac) less. About 4/5 as much.
- There are 1561 more hours of sunlight per year in Johannesburg. In whichever way circa 4h 16' more per day or about 2 as many.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 29° higher in Johannesburg than in Lyngvig Fyr.
